Why the 2021-S Washington Crossing the Delaware Quarter Is Unique
The 2021-S quarter is unique because it features a detailed design of George Washington’s historic river crossing, making it visually distinct from regular quarters. Minted in San Francisco, this silver proof coin has a mirror-like finish, which gives it a striking appearance. Proof coins like this one are made with special processes that enhance their detail and quality, making them highly sought after.

How to Identify a 2021-S Silver Proof Quarter
To identify an authentic 2021-S silver proof quarter, look for the “S” mint mark, which indicates it was made at the San Francisco Mint. The coin should also have a mirror-like finish, typical of proof coins, with crisp details on Washington and the river scene. If you’re unsure, consider getting the coin graded by a professional service, as this can confirm its authenticity and add value.
